The Agricultural Process of Sugar Walking Stick Farming



Although sugar cane growing may differ by area, the fundamental agricultural procedure remains regular. The primary step includes choosing high-yielding ranges ideal for neighborhood climates. Preparation of the soil is crucial, frequently needing tillage and the addition of fertilizers to improve fertility. Growing usually happens during the wet season, with farmers utilizing either whole stalks or cuttings to establish new crops.As the plants grow, they require persistent care, including weed control, insect administration, and irrigation, depending upon the environmental problems. Farmers keep an eye on the sugar walking cane's development cycle, which normally covers 10 to 24 months, before harvesting. Harvesting is labor-intensive, frequently conducted manually or with specialized equipment, making certain marginal damages to the stalks. Complying with harvest, the cane is transferred to processing centers. Sugar Manufacturing: From Cane to Crystal



The trip of sugar production starts the moment freshly collected sugar cane comes to processing facilities. The primary step involves chopping the walking stick and cleaning to prepare it for removal. Making use of high-pressure rollers, the juice is drawn out from the crushed cane, leading to a sweet fluid called sugarcane juice. This juice undertakes clarification, where contaminations are gotten rid of through the addition of lime and heat.Next, the made clear juice is focused by boiling it down to develop a thick syrup. This syrup is then taken shape by cooling down, allowing sugar crystals to develop. The taken shape sugar is separated from the continuing to be syrup, referred to as molasses, with centrifugation.Finally, the sugar crystals are cleaned and dried, leading to the acquainted granulated sugar (What Are Sugar Canes Used For). Sugar Cane in Rum



Rum manufacturing is elaborately connected to the growing of sugar cane, an important plant that offers the necessary fermentable sugars required for fermentation. This process starts with the removal of juice from gathered sugar canes, which is after that either fermented directly or processed right into molasses. Yeast is added to transform the sugars into alcohol, causing a diverse variety of rum designs, from light to dark varieties. The geographical area where the sugar cane is grown greatly influences the taste account of the rum, with elements such as dirt kind and climate playing crucial functions. Nations like Barbados, Jamaica, and Cuba are renowned for their rum production, reflecting the historical and social relevance of sugar cane within the global beverage market.

Biofuels From Sugar Walking Cane



Just how can the byproducts of sugar walking stick add to lasting energy services? The conversion of sugar walking stick into biofuels provides an encouraging avenue for renewable resource. By making use of the coarse deposit, referred to as bagasse, manufacturers can generate bioethanol through fermentation processes. This bioethanol can serve as a lasting option to nonrenewable fuel sources, minimizing greenhouse gas emissions and dependence on non-renewable resources. Furthermore, molasses, one more by-product, can be fermented to produce biofuels, optimizing source performance. The power created from sugar walking stick not only supplies a cleaner gas source yet also boosts the total financial stability of sugar manufacturing. Ecological Considerations in Sugar Cane Farming



While sugar walking stick farming plays an essential function in many economic climates, it also increases substantial environmental worries that can not be overlooked. The considerable use fertilizers and chemicals in sugar cane growing usually leads to soil destruction and water pollution. Overflow from these chemicals can infect nearby water bodies, harming water ecosystems. Furthermore, the monoculture techniques widespread in sugar cane farming decrease biodiversity, making ecosystems a lot more at risk to insects and diseases.Deforestation is another vital issue, as land is frequently gotten rid of to make way for sugar haciendas, causing environment loss for wild animals and raised carbon emissions. In addition, the high water consumption needed for sugar walking cane irrigation can strain local water these details resources, particularly in deserts.
